The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 1978 Endeavour 32 is a classic cruiser known for its solid construction and comfortable accommodations. Here are some of the pros and cons of this model:
Pros
Sturdy Build: The Endeavour 32 features a robust fiberglass hull, providing durability and seaworthiness.
Spacious Interior: For a 32-foot boat, it offers a surprisingly roomy cabin with ample headroom and comfortable living space.
Traditional Design: Its classic lines and full keel design contribute to good tracking and stability under sail.
Easy Handling: The sail plan and rigging are designed for manageable handling, making it suitable for short-handed crews or cruising couples.
Good Storage: There is generous storage below decks, which is ideal for extended cruising.
Cons
Performance: While stable, the full keel design can limit speed and agility compared to more modern fin keel boats.
Age-Related Wear: As a vessel from 1978, some boats may require updates or maintenance to rigging, systems, and interior components.
Limited Modern Amenities: The original fittings and equipment may lack some of the conveniences found in newer sailboats unless upgraded.
Draft Considerations: The deeper draft may restrict access to shallower anchorages or marinas.
